Output 269e424d27c479bab940bf5fb7a9e10a21bfd664b5bef5bc0c23734f72abd3f6:64

value
10259900
script pubkey
OP_0 OP_PUSHBYTES_20 ef6fd8763f2d0c3fe9b2e49701d08e5c7239242c
address
bc1qaahasa3l95xrl6djujtsr5ywt3erjfpvqp6899
transaction
269e424d27c479bab940bf5fb7a9e10a21bfd664b5bef5bc0c23734f72abd3f6